#c59253 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c59253 is composed of 77.3% red, 57.3%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 33.2 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 54.9%. #c59253 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#8b2500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c59253 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c59253 has RGB values of R:197, G:146,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.58,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12948051.

Shades and Tints of #c59253
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c59253
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908c88 is the less saturated color, while #fa981e is the most saturated one.
